Downstream impacts of a dam and influence of a tributary on the reproductive success of Leporinus reinhardti in S?o Francisco River

ABSTRACT: Downstream impacts of dams on fish fauna are poorly studied, despite causing thermal and hydrological changes that affect the reproductive activity of the fish community. The present study aims to evaluate the reproduction of Leporinus reinhardti in 2 sections of the S?o Francisco River, Brazil, downstream from the Três Marias Dam. Section 1 (S1) is the first 34 km downstream from Três Marias Dam and section 2 (S2) is 34 to 54 km downstream from the dam, where the S?o Francisco River receives a mid-sized tributary called the Abaeté River. In S1, the values of temperature, dissolved oxygen and flow were lower than those obtained in S2. In S1, females and males did not complete reproduction, a fact proven by the absence of spawned females and males. In S2, reproductive success was proven due to the presence of spawned females and males. Furthermore, the values of total length, body weight, gonadosomatic index, fecundity and vitellogenic oocytes were statistically higher than those obtained in S1. The canonical correlation test indicated that the reproduction of females is more dependent on environmental factors than that of males. In S2, L. reinhadti found appropriate conditions for reproduction, probably influenced by the Abaeté River, confirming the need of preserving this tributary for the reproductive success of this species.
